From: Karyotype diversity and 2C DNA content in species of the Caesalpinia group

Fig. 1

Application of fluorochromes in the Caesalpinia group. The fluorochromes DAPI (a, d, g, j) and CMA3 (b, e, h, k), as well as the FISH (c, g, i, l) with a probe for 45S rDNA on metaphase chromosomes. a - c Cynostigma macrophyllum, (d - f) Erythrostemon calycina, (g - i) Poincianella pluviosa and (j - l) Libidibia ferrea. White arrows indicate CMA3+/DAPI blocks, orange arrows indicate CMA3+ blocks, and red arrows indicate 45S rDNA sites; a bar is 10 μm
